> 3 dayFor years, Ive been using the jumbo scatterless litter boxes from Ware for my Holland lop rabbits. Recently, I needed a litter box with a shallow entry for a bunny who was having surgery, and this was the only one that was both shallow enough AND large enough for a rabbit (my rabbits are 3-5 pounds), a pile of hay, and a plenty of room for a bunny butt. Although ridiculously overpriced for a plastic bin with grate, I have to say that the plastic is very thick, smooth, and appears to be durable. I like that the mesh grate is made of wide plastic rungs instead of metal so its easier on the bunnys feet but still spaced wide enough to allow most poops through. The grate latches a bit at the front and is easy to left for cleaning, and I appreciate that there is no annoying slide-out tray to accumulate urine or mashed cecotropes (wet, tiny bunny poops). Overall, my only minor gripes are the lack of a way to attach this to an enclosure (no clips) and the massive cost. Considering the quality of the litter box, plastic grate, and extremely generous size, I am pleased with my purchase even though my wallet is quite empty now.

07-06-2025I ordered this litterbox after watching Hooks Hollands review up on her YouTube channel. Its everything she said it was and I introduced it to my 4 rabbits as soon as it arrived in the mail. My bunnies were hesitant to use this litterbox at first, as they are used to standing directly on their litter rather than how this one is set up which has a grate separating them from touching the litter. I added a hay rack right above the box and placed a bit of hay directly on the grate which enticed them to use their new box. If your bunny is having a hard time transitioning to this type of set up try adding in a little bit of their soiled litter until they get the hang of the box each time you change it out. If you are curious about the size, trust me I was too when I was contemplating ordering this box. My largest bunny is just under 4 pounds and you could 100% fit another bunny his size in the box at the same time and there would still be room leftover. The bunny that is in the photo I have included is not yet an adult so he probably isnt the most helpful example of size reference. If you have a large rabbit like a Flemish Giant, Continental Giant, or Checkered Giant I wouldnt buy this product, but I think it could work for a rabbit up to 7 or 8 lbs. I will agree that the price of this litterbox is outrageous and its difficult to justify buying what is essentially a sturdy plastic, but my rabbits are what I enjoy spending my time and money on so I see it more as an investment.
